Job Specific Knowledge
  • Sound knowledge in basics of electrical and electronics engineering
  • Experience in electrical panel design, cable and harness design using any AutoCAD / E‑plan / Zuken E3S or any other tool
  • Switchgear and auxiliary components selection
  • Calculate load ampere requirements and select proper cables as per standards
  • Understanding of controller based automation like Digital I/O & Analog I/O
  • Hands on experience in field instrumentation and knowledge about different sensors/measurement methods
  • Aware of industrial communication protocols such as Device Net, Ethernet & Ether CAT
  • Good understanding of IEC & NEMA standards and implement in design; knowledge on SEMI S2 Standards is an added advantage
